#a27060 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a27060 is composed of 63.5% red, 43.9%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 40.7%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 14.5 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#a27060 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0c0 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#a27060 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#a27060 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a27060 has RGB values of R:162, G:112,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.41,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10645600.

Shades and Tints of #a27060
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#f9f6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a27060
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#857f7d is the less saturated color, while #f94309 is the most saturated one.
